21 Conifer Crescent, Clifton, Nottingham, NG11 9EQ is a freehold terraced property built between 1950-1966. The property offers approximately 915 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£170,253 , which equates to approximately £186 per square foot. It was last sold on 10 Jun 2022 for £161,000. Since then, the value has increased by £9,253, representing a 5.7% increase, or approximately 1.6% per year.

The current estimated value of £170,253 is:

  • 2.5% lower than the average property price on Conifer Crescent
  • 4.9% lower than the average in the NG11 9EQ postcode area
  • and 49.5% lower than the average price for Nottingham as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 13 October 2008,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

21 Conifer Crescent, Clifton, Nottingham, City Of Nottingham, Nottinghamshire, NG11 9EQ has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 4 Nov 2015.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are mostly double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 13 Oct 2008. The rating of E rem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 25.6%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from average to good, while the heating system type remained the same (boiler and radiators, mains gas).
  • The hot water system was changed from from main system, no cylinderstat to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from poor to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 25 mm loft insulation to pitched,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from poor to very poor.
  • The windows were upgraded from fully double glazed to mostly double glazing.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in 80%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
